Contributing to Commerce Core

How to extend DreamBees Art without breaking frozen protocols. Read commerce-protocol-frozen.md first — this doc is the practical checklist.


Golden rules

  1. Routes are thin — parse, guard, delegate, adapt. No Stripe. No batchUpdateStock.
  2. Protocols return results — use *Result<T>, don't throw for expected failures.
  3. Idempotency by default — any retryable mutation needs a key and claim store.
  4. Update verification ladders — if you change protocol behavior, update the matching *-verification-ladder.test.ts.
  5. Leave money paths alone unless the use case is new and approved.

Decision tree: where does my change go?

Does it move money (charge or refund)?
├── YES → checkout or refunds protocol
│         Charge:  services.checkout
│         Refund:  services.refunds (admin via requestRefund)
└── NO
    Does it change sellable stock?
    ├── YES → services.inventory (admin may authorize via services.admin)
    └── NO
        Does it need operator authorization / audit?
        ├── YES → services.admin
        └── NO → appropriate read service or domain rule (ProductService, OrderQueryService, …)

Adding a new API route

Read-only route

1. Create src/app/api/.../route.ts
2. requireSessionUser or public GET
3. Delegate to query service / repository via container
4. Return JSON (jsonError on failure)
5. Add route test if behavior is non-trivial

Mutation route (commerce)

1. Identify protocol (checkout | refunds | inventory | admin)
2. Add method to ApplicationService interface + FlowService if new public capability
3. Implement in flow module with *Result return
4. Wire in create*Stack factory if new dependency
5. Route: guard → parse → services.{protocol}.method → route adapter
6. Add verification ladder test + seal test if new entry point

Anti-pattern (will fail review)

// ❌ Route calling Stripe directly
const stripe = getStripeService();
await stripe.refund(...);

// ✅ Admin route
const result = await services.admin.requestRefund({ actor, orderId, amount, reason, idempotencyKey });

Protocol change checklist

Before opening a PR that touches src/core/order/, src/core/inventory/, src/core/refund/, or src/core/admin/:

  • Change is inside FlowService or flow module, not a new route shortcut
  • Public method returns *Result<T> with correct error codes
  • Idempotency considered (new claim collection or existing marker)
  • Route adapter maps new codes to HTTP statuses
  • Structured logs include correlation ids
  • Verification ladder test added or updated
  • Seal test confirms routes don't import forbidden services
  • flows.md updated if user-visible story changed
  • No change to frozen policy without explicit intent

Run:

npm run test:storefront-release   # if storefront/cart/checkout touched
npm test -- --run src/tests/*-verification-ladder.test.ts
npm run typecheck
npm run lint

Code review questions

Ask these of any commerce PR:

  1. Can this mutation be retried safely without double effect?
  2. Does every failure path return a typed result (not throw) at the protocol boundary?
  3. Is there a test that would fail if someone later imported refundService in a route?
  4. Does an operator know what happened from logs/audit?
  5. Is this the smallest change that solves the use case?
